Assessment & Diagnostic Imaging
We'll start the consultation by chatting with you about your concerns and goals for treatment. We'll also take some 'Before' photos of your smile.
Next, we'll conduct a thorough examination. This will include some diagnostic imaging to get a comprehensive picture of your dental health. We'll create a 3D digital image of your teeth using our iTero® scanner. These images will be used down the road to create whatever orthodontic appliance you may need.
We can also use the iTero scanner to perform a digital outcome simulation for you. This will allow you to see how your results may look at the end of treatment!

Customized Treatment Plan
At this point in the process, you'll meet with our treatment coordinator to discuss your health history (if needed) and review the imaging, outlining indications for orthodontic treatment.
Based on the findings from your exam and imaging, our orthodontist will diagnose your condition and develop a customized treatment plan to resolve it and meet your goals. Our treatment coordinator will review this plan with you, and our orthodontist will go over the finer details with you as well.
This plan will include treatment recommendations, a projected timeline for treatment completion, and an appointment schedule.
We'll also discuss a payment game plan for your treatment. This will include your insurance coverage and payment plan should you like to take advantage of that option.
